During Ulises's absence, (Eduard Fernández), a wealthy property developer and construction magnate who had fruitlessly pursued Martina in the past, steps back into her life. Left alone with a young son and no income, Martina succumbs to the stability Sierra offers. They marry, and Martina is thrust into a life of immense luxury, complete with a lavish mansion, high fashion, and material comfort. Yet, she remains emotionally empty. Their happiness is short-lived when Ulises mysteriously disappears at sea during a fishing trip. Presumed dead, a mourning Martina eventually marries Sierra to provide for her child and enters a life of comfort and luxury. However, five years later, Ulises unexpectedly returns, revealing he had been living in solitude and realized his deep need for Martina. The two begin a secret affair, leading to a dangerous love triangle that culminates in a tragic and poetic attempt to escape their reality. In essence, the user is looking for the
